About the Position
- The Hospital Liaison will focus on coordinating patient care in hospital settingslocatedacross the Buffalo, NY area.
- Assistsocial workers and discharge planners to create individual equipment plans for a safe discharge.
- Educate patients, hospital staff, and physicians on durable medical equipment usage and insurance qualifications.
- Review and analyze patient clinical charts todetermineinsurance coverage and qualifications for durable medical equipment.
- Obtain proper documentation tosubmit toinsurance and conduct insurance verifications across multiple computer platforms.
- Maintain adequate stock in consignment closets, including daily inventory checks and documenting in Microsoft Excel.
- Size and supply equipment to meet patient needs and coordinate deliveries with caregivers and home agencies.
- Enter patient records and orders into an electronic order database.
- Jumpin toproblem-solvein real time when barriers to discharge arise, collaborating with hospital partners and internal teams.
- Be on your feet off and on for 6–8 hours per day while safely maneuvering carts with equipment throughout the hospital.
- Engage with patients, families, and hospital staff in an outgoing, approachable manner while knowing when to pause, listen, and respond with empathy.
- Manage competing priorities, make sound judgment calls, and follow through on tasks to completion with minimal supervision.
